About Pharos Marine Automatic Power
More than 100 years in the making, Pharos Marine Automatic Power, Inc. has set the standard in providing high quality engineered marine navigational aids with complete support services in the oil and gas and ports and harbors industries. Today, PMAPI provides the latest innovative designs, most advanced signaling products and customer focused technical services throughout the world. Our global experience and resources are a proven competitive advantage in the harsh environments related to offshore oil platforms, ports and harbors, lighthouse authorities, bridge and traffic signaling, aviation obstruction applications, and many other industries where navigational and personal safety is of primary concern. Pharos Marine was founded more than 100 years ago; the company’s founder, Gustav Dalen, had a distinguished career, winning a Nobel Prize when he introduced a system of acetylene gas lights capable of operating for a year without service. Originating in 1947 as The Lighthouse, Inc., Automatic Power Inc. provided aids to navigation for the first oil rigs of the coast of Texas. In 1989, the two companies merged, establishing a combined world leader in the Nav-Aids field. Today Pharos Marine Automatic Power is a Portfolio Company of Toxaway Capital Partners and has strategic locations in Houston, Louisiana, Pennsylvania, California, London and Singapore, as well as a worldwide network of agents and distributors. The worldwide network of agents, engineers, and salesmen endows the Pharos Marine Automatic Power team with the endless ability to consult the application of products, engineer custom projects, and explore unique, innovative application of its products. With a combined century of experience in a highly regulatory business environment, Pharos Marine Automatic Power provides a one-stop-shop option for offshore aids-to-navigation.
